Abstract:
With the development of medical technology and materials science, the structure optimization method of bioabsorbable materials for implantable medical devices becomes more and more important, and the absorbable interface screw is the most representative device in implantable medical devices. Based on the previous parametric design method for the loading and structural characteristics of the interface screw, this paper assembled the interface screw and cancellous bone with the tunnel hole and simulated the graft fixation after cruciate ligaments surgery. In this study, through the finite element method, the mechanical properties of interface screws with different structural parameters obtained by parametric design were comprehensively evaluated from the aspects of stress and strain energy density. © Published under licence by IOP Publishing Ltd.
